A word of warning! When you order a dress our suppliers will make the dress to fit you using the measurements we take. If, between ordering and delivery your size changes the dress is unlikely to fit perfectly and it may be difficult or even impossible to rectify. For this reason we strongly advise that you do not attempt to diet or otherwise change your sizing between ordering your dress and your wedding day. If your size has changed we will try our best to get the best fit possible, including getting our seamstresses to work on the dress. Modifications of this type are excluded from out "clear pricing policy" and will need to be paid for by you when you collect the dress.
How far in advance should I start looking for my dress?
We get brides in looking at dresses 2 years before their wedding date but most seem to start their hunt about 9 months before the big day. For many brides getting the venue and finding their dress are steps that must be completed before they can start to think about the million and one other things you need to arrange for a wedding and so like to start early. We would ideally like to see brides-to-be about 9 months before their wedding day and take the order no later than 4 months before. It can take as long as 12 weeks to get your dress into the shop from ordering and we like to give ourselves at least 4 weeks before the wedding day to ensure that you are 100% happy before you take it away.
How quickly can you get a dress in?
12 weeks is our standard delivery time and we like a 4 week "buffer zone" that we can use to sort our anything that the bride-to-be is not happy with in good time. However, we can get dresses delivered in 4 weeks although there are often extra costs associated with this. Generally anything below 12 weeks means that your options start to reduce but the message from us is "if time is limited come and see us as soon as possible"... we will move heaven and earth to try to get you the dress you want in your timeframe.
